SANTA BARBARA, CA -- (Marketwired) -- 11/11/13 -- Eucalyptus Systems, the leading provider of open source software for building AWS-compatible private and hybrid clouds, today announced its sponsorship and participation at AWS re:Invent, taking place November 12-15, 2013 in Las Vegas, Nevada. Eucalyptus will showcase how to develop applications locally and deploy globally using the combination of Eucalyptus and AWS clouds. Key activities Eucalyptus will be hosting and participating in include:
AWS re:Invent GameDay
When: November 12 at 11:00 a.m. P.T.
Where: Room Venetian B
Details: Limited to the first 100 participants, GameDay aims to teach cloud developers how to diagnose, repair and protect against broken cloud applications. In a live competition, teams will build their own loosely coupled, auto-scaling applications on-site. Once applications are built, teams will attempt to break their opponents' systems in the sneakiest and most nefarious ways possible, while simultaneously trying to maintain their own workload. While the majority of these exercises will be run on the AWS cloud, Eucalyptus has been invited to contribute by allowing GameDay participants to run tests on a EucaNUC cloud, demonstrating key AWS API compatibility.

About Eucalyptus Systems
Eucalyptus Systems provides progressive IT organizations in enterprises and technology businesses with the leading open source software for building AWS-compatible private clouds. Eucalyptus supports industry-standard AWS APIs, including EC2, S3, EBS, ELB, Auto Scaling, CloudWatch and IAM. By providing an open source platform for cloud computing, Eucalyptus is dedicated to the success of its active and rapidly growing ecosystem of customers, partners, developers and researchers.
